Item | Description | Price | A | 1600 Carb Chain Tensioner AUTOMATIC | USD 26.00 | B | 1600 Carb Tension Shoe OEM | USD 6.50 | C | 1600 Carb Vibration Damper OEM | USD 5.00 | D | 1700 Carb & TBI Chain Tensioner AUTOMATIC | USD 26.00 | E | 1700 Carb & TBI Tension Shoe OEM | USD 10.00 | F | 1700 Carb & TBI Vibration Damper OEM | USD 5.00 | G | Tappet (Valve) Cover Gasket | USD 5.00 | H | Timing Cover Gasket | USD 1.00 | I | Front Crankshaft Oil Seal | USD 4.00 | J | Complete 1600 Engine Gasket Set | USD 20.00 | K | Complete 1700 Carb Engine Gasket Set | USD 20.00 |
Prices have been provided by Keith and updated, USD is the abbreviation for US Dollars ($).
